Overview
Represents an alternation pattern in pattern matching.
foo => bar | baz
^^^^^^^^^

Instance Method Details
#===(other) ⇒ Object
Implements case-equality for the node. This is effectively == but without comparing the value of locations. Locations are checked only for presence.
500 501 502 503 504 505 |
# File 'lib/prism/node.rb', line 500 def ===(other) other.is_a?(AlternationPatternNode) && (left === other.left) && (right === other.right) && (operator_loc.nil? == other.operator_loc.nil?) end |
